<br />LEGAL NOTICE
<br />Clyde Couch, 122 State Street,
<br />Sterling, CO 80751 (970-522-1239) has
<br />filed an application- to
<br />amend an existing Construction
<br />Materials "Regular 110 Operation
<br />Reclamation Permit with the
<br />Folorado Mined Land Reclama- 1
<br />bon Board under the provisions
<br />of the Colorado Land Reclama-,
<br />Hon .Act for the Extraction -of
<br />Construction Materials. ' The
<br />mine to-- be amended is >known
<br />as'Caliche School Pit (M-1989-023). It
<br />is located in the NE 1/4,i
<br />Of Section 29, T10N, R50W of the
<br />6th P.M., ' Logan- County, Colorad-
<br />o. The proposed date of com-
<br />mencement is as -soon as possi-
<br />ble and the proposed date of
<br />completion is 2020. The pro-
<br />posed future use of the pit area
<br />is for rangeland.
<br />Additional '.`information and ten-
<br />tative hearing date may be ob-
<br />tained from the Mined' Land Rec
<br />Iamation Board, -Room' 215, ` 1313
<br />Sherman Street, Denver, Colo-
<br />rado 80203 (303-866-3567), or
<br />the Logan County Clerk, Logan
<br />County Courthouse, 315 Main
<br />Street, Sterling, CO' or the above
<br />named applicant. A- complete
<br />copy of the application is avail-
<br />able at the : above-named County
<br />Clerk and : Recorder's office and
<br />at the Division's office.
<br />Comments concerning the appli-
<br />cations and -exhibits must be
<br />filed - in writing and must be re-
<br />ceived by the Division of Recla-
<br />mation, Mining and Safety . by
<br />4:00 p.m. on October 26, 2010.
